Comments (6)I received a similar email yesterday that might be easier to fall for. It was purportedly from the technical support team & webmail account admin, It stated that my in box was full and to be reactivated I was to send info such as my log in info and password. This looked like it could be real except it didn't mention my name, had at least one misspelled word, legitimate businesses don't ask for that info in an email, and I am still getting mail.
